Tunisia-UGTT freezes the activities of a union official suspected of corruption

The UGTT decided to momentarily halt the activities of the secretary-general of the regional labour union in Tataouine “for legal and trade union failures”.

The decision was made public on Wednesday, December 23, 2020, by the Internal Rules Committee of the UGTT. It will be in force until the official appears before a committee of the central trade union and proves his integrity of the charges brought against him by various parties.

According to sources quoted by Jawhara FM, the regional secretary general of Tataouine supposedly asked a bribe from one of the companies established in southern Tunisia in exchange for suspending strikes
